  • Menopause Explained

    28/07/2022 Duration: 14min

    If you’re approaching "middle-age," you may be a little confused and nervous about the idea of menopause. Most likely, this is because this time of life for women has long held negative connotations in our society, largely tied to stigmas of aging. However, the transition to menopause can be a time of reflection and inspiration. It’s a normal and natural part of a woman’s life, and it can be just as well lived as earlier stages. When it comes down to it, it has a lot to do with mindset. The menopause phase is a time of change and with that, it's also a time of choice. The mindset with which you approach this transition can have a huge impact on your experience of it. Of course, the symptoms and changes that come with this phase aren’t always avoidable, but how you experience it and the years that follow has much to do with your how you think about it and choose to behave.
